EIP通讯协议,即以太网工业协议(EtherNet/IP),是一种基于以太网技术的高效、灵活且开放的工业通信协议。它旨在实现不同品牌和设备之间的数据交换和通信,广泛应用于工业自动化领域。
一、 EIP通讯协议简介
1. 基本特点
- 基于以太网:EIP使用现代化的以太网技术,传输速度快,成本低。
- 兼容性:与TCP/IP协议兼容,支持面向对象的通讯方式和基于OSI模型的通信规范。
- 实时性:支持实时数据传输和控制,满足工业自动化系统对实时性的要求。
- 开放性:作为一种开放的协议,EIP拥有广泛的应用领域和厂家支持。
2. 技术背景
EIP协议是建立在标准的以太网硬件和软件之上,利用传统的以太网物理层和数据链路层来定义应用层协议。其报文通常由命令码、数据长度、数据和状态等字段组成,这有助于解析和处理实际的通讯数据,确保通讯的准确性和稳定性。
3. 应用场景
EIP允许欧姆龙PLC与各种智能设备进行高速、可靠的数据交换,相比于传统的串行通讯具有更高的通讯速率。此外,它还被用于实现不同厂家EtherNet/IP设备之间的通讯,如罗克韦尔自动化的ControlNet和DeviceNet控制和信息协议(CIP)。
4. 实际应用
在实际应用中,EIP可以用于传输循环的I/O数据以及异步参数数据,并且支持多种对象类型,如Identity Object、Assembly Object、Connection Management Object等。例如,在灵猴机械手与欧姆龙PLC的通讯中,EIP就发挥了重要作用。
5. 发展前景
随着工业自动化技术的迅猛发展,EIP协议也在不断演进。未来的发展方向包括进一步提高通讯效率、增强系统的互操作性和扩展更多的应用场景。
总之,EIP通讯协议以其高效、灵活和开放的特点,在工业自动化领域得到了广泛应用,并将继续推动工业通信技术的进步和发展。
二、 EIP通讯协议的最新版本引入了哪些新特性?
EIP通讯协议的最新版本是eip-cip-v2-1.0.该版本于2024年1月7日发布。与之前的版本相比,eip-cip-v2-1.0 引入了以下新特性:
- 标准化:遵循国际标准,确保不同厂商的设备之间的兼容性和互操作性。
- 高效性:优化了数据传输效率,减少了通信延迟,提高了整体性能。
三、 如何在不同品牌和型号的设备之间实现EIP通讯协议的兼容性?
在不同品牌和型号的设备之间实现EIP通讯协议的兼容性,需要采取一系列步骤和工具来确保各设备之间的有效通信。以下是详细的实现方法:
1. 选择合适的软件工具:
对于ABB机器人控制器,可以使用RobotStudio软件进行EIP通信的配置。具体步骤包括打开RobotStudio软件并连接机器人控制器,在主菜单中选择“通讯”-“设备配置”,然后在设备配置窗口中找到与EIP通信相关的选项卡,并配置EIP通信参数。
欧姆龙NX/NJ系列可以通过sysmac studio软件内置的EtherNet IP工具手动建立EIP连接。通过设置两台PLC的IP地址和子网掩码,分配输入输出变量,并在控制器中打开EtherNetIP连接设置工具进行注册,即可实现数据交互。
2. 配置网络参数:
倍福PLC与EIP通讯的设置包括配置IP地址、子网掩码和网关等网络参数,以及选择正确的通讯模块并进行相关的编程。
在欧姆龙PLC的案例中,同样需要设置IP地址和子网掩码,并分配输入输出变量,以确保数据能够正确传输。
3. 使用智能网关:
可以使用如埃和智能的IGT-DSER智能网关,支持不同品牌的PLC之间多对多通讯。这种网关可以调整字节大小,以适应不同的通信需求。
4. 硬件配置和测试:
硬件配置方面,需要确保所有设备都支持标准工业Ethernet/IP协议,并且具备相应的端口数量和物理局域网连接选项。例如,晨控CK-FR208-EIP是一款支持标准工业Ethernet/IP协议的多通道工业RFID读写器,可以与欧姆龙PLC进行通信。
进行通信测试时,可以参考西门子PLC S7-1200与派克ACR9000之间的通信案例,通过硬件配置、软件设置和通信测试等步骤来验证通信的有效性。
5. 其他注意事项:
在某些情况下,可能需要考虑网络兼容性和防火墙功能,以确保可靠的音频传输和网络通信。例如,E-IPA-HX Audio-over-IP Interface Card支持多种协议和接口,具有I.V.核心接口、网络兼容性、防火墙功能和质量服务等特性。
四、 EIP通讯协议在工业自动化领域的应用案例有哪些?
EIP(Ethernet/IP)通讯协议在工业自动化领域的应用案例非常广泛,涵盖了从PLC通信到RFID读写器的连接等多个方面。以下是几个具体的应用案例:
基恩士PLC通过EIP协议与晨控RFID进行通讯,利用以太网实现数据传输和控制指令的传递。这种应用展示了EIP协议在实时数据交换和设备监控方面的优势。
在这个案例中,赫优讯NT151网关被用来完成ACR9000 Class 1 IO(EIP)与S7-1200(PROFINET)之间的通信。该方案验证了EIP协议在实际工业自动化中的可行性,并且可以调整ACR9000各轴的各种输出参数。
汇川PLC与基恩士PLC通过EIP通讯协议实现了联机操作,以控制4轴上下料机械手为例,展示了不同品牌PLC之间通过EIP协议进行通信的可能性和实用性。
安川机器人通过EIP协议与汇川PLC连接,实现了数据交换和控制指令的传递。这一实例说明了EIP协议在机器人与PLC之间的高效通信能力。
EIP通讯广泛应用于工业自动化领域,包括生产线控制、设备监控、数据采集和远程维护等方面。通过EIP通讯,工业设备之间可以实现实时数据交换和控制指令传输,从而提高生产效率并降低运营成本。
五、 EIP通讯协议与其他工业通信协议(如TCP/IP)相比有哪些优势和劣势?
EIP通讯协议(以太网IP)与传统的TCP/IP和其他工业通信协议相比,具有以下优势和劣势:
1. 优势:
- 灵活性:EIP作为云上独立的资源,在需要的时候可以随时绑定在VPC网络的ECS/SLB/NAT等实例上,在不需要的时候也可以随时解绑,非常灵活自由。
- 高效率:EIP利用了TCP/IP的特点,使用了传统以太网中的所有传输和控制协议,包括传输控制协议、网络协议等,从而提高了数据传输的效率。
- 改进的响应时间和数据吞吐量:EIP提供了比DeviceNet和ControlNet更好的响应时间和更大的数据吞吐量。它将设备从传感器总线层连接到控制层再到企业层,提供一致的应用层接口。
- 兼容性:EIP能够与西门子或施耐德的多个自动化设备兼容,包括施耐德电气M340自动机和C1100速度调节器,这使得其在工业自动化领域中具有较高的应用价值。
2. 劣势:
- 可靠性问题:虽然EIP继承了TCP/IP的一些优点,但其本身是基于以太网的,而以太网是无连接的、不可靠的,这意味着数据包可能会丢失、损坏或乱序到达,无法满足对高可靠性要求的应用场景。
- 配置复杂性:尽管EIP易于配置和部署,缩短了开发时间并降低了成本,但在某些情况下,特别是在大规模网络环境中,配置和维护可能仍然较为复杂。
- 性能瓶颈:由于EIP依赖于以太网基础设施,因此在带宽有限的情况下可能会出现性能瓶颈,影响整体的数据传输效率。
EIP通讯协议在灵活性、高效率和兼容性方面表现优异,特别适合需要快速部署和灵活调整的工业环境。
六、 未来EIP通讯协议的发展趋势
未来EIP通讯协议的发展趋势和潜在的技术革新可以从多个方面进行探讨。
从技术层面来看,EIP协议将继续与其他通信协议和技术相结合,以构建更完善的工业互联网生态系统。这种融合将推动现代科技的进一步发展。例如,POE(Power over Ethernet)技术作为以太网的一部分,其不断进化和扩展的应用场景,如无线接入点、安全摄像头等,预示着未来EIP协议在电力传输和数据传输方面的结合将更加紧密。
以太坊改进提案(EIP)是另一个重要的发展方向。EIP不仅代表了以太坊区块链内协作进步的顶峰,还描述了对现有技术的改进和新功能特性的建议。例如,EIP-7702提出了一系列创新的技术方案,包括新的共识算法和数据处理方式,这些改进预计将大幅提升网络的交易处理能力和安全性。此外,EIP-1559通过改变费用结构和引入燃烧机制,旨在提高用户的交易体验和网络的安全性。
社区的参与和反馈也是EIP协议发展的重要因素。整个社区共同决定网络的发展方向,这使得EIP协议能够促进以太坊的创新、开放性和多样性。这种机制确保了EIP协议能够适应不断变化的技术需求和用户期望。
未来EIP通讯协议的发展趋势将集中在与其他技术的融合、持续的技术创新以及社区驱动的改进上。